Muzzamil, you will be able to do that as first year syllabus for all engineering streams is same and after first year the syllabus changes and branch specific course start. So, you can take lateral entry in B.Tech 2nd year on basis of your diploma.
Some institutes give admission on basis of LEET exam and some give admission on basis of your marks in diploma.
Some institutes also offer scholarships on basis of your marks in previous qualification.
Check the websites of some institutes for more details.

B.Tech CSE with specialisation will restrict your options of further studies and type of job you will get after graduation. I will recommend B.Tech CSE over B.Tech CSE with specialisation as you will be able to chose your own destiny after gaining CS knowledge and judging your interests areas and abilities. Further it advised that you may do your specialisation in M.Tech or MS.

MCA or Master of Computer Application is a general Master's degree course related with computer application.It simultaneously deals with software and hardware functions and implementations.
On the other hand, a B.Tech in Computer Science and Engineering is a technical Bachelor's degree course, which is also related with software and hardware.
But the difference in these two is that an MCA student knows the theory part of software and hardware more than a B.Tech student and a B.Tech student knows the technical implementation of things better.
More or less,goals of both are same and job prospects also are equal for both.
